Perchlorate at Orcutt Ranch
Residents fear lab contamination has spread

By Kerry Cavanaugh
Los Angeles Daily News
March 31, 2006

WEST HILLS - State toxics officials detected low levels of perchlorate in the soil at city-owned Orcutt Ranch, prompting more tests for the rocket-fuel ingredient at nearby Justice Street Elementary School.

California Department of Toxic Substances Control officials said the perchlorate levels are too low to jeopardize neighbors or ranch visitors, although residents fear that chemical contamination from the nearby Santa Susana Field Lab may have spread.

"This confirms our worst fears. Everywhere they look for contamination, they find it, which is why we have been so insistent about testing," said Elizabeth Crawford, senior environmental analyst with Physicians for Social Responsibility.
